Bunk Beds Are Cooler Than Ever

Whether you're designing an area for children to share, outfitting a dorm or simply maximizing your space bunk beds are a great choice and more stylish than ever. There are many designs, including twin-overtwins and full over-full versions.

Pick the right bunk bed within your budget and the dimensions of the room your child will be sharing. Some bunk beds can accommodate trundle mattresses in the bottom to accommodate sleepovers.

The size of bunk beds is an important consideration before buying a bed, particularly in relation to the height of your ceilings. Make sure you measure your space prior to buying bunk beds to make sure they fit. The top bunk should have at 5 inches of headroom. We also suggest avoid Trundle beds with mattresses that hang high that can limit headroom and increase the possibility of bumped heads.

Another factor to consider is whether you prefer stairs or ladders to get to the top bunk beds beds. Stairs are generally safer and easier to climb, but they could take up more space than a ladder. Ladders aren't as bulky and more cost-effective, but they may feel too steep for younger children.

On the product page on the product page, you'll find the weight capacity of every top bunk mattress. This information is typically displayed close to the dimensions of the mattress. A higher capacity of weight suggests that the kid bunk beds was made for older children or adults who might need a larger mattress.

Safety

When you are looking for a Bunk beds stores bed it is crucial to look past the price tag and make sure it is equipped with the safety features you need. A reputable seller lists the weight capacity and also explains the structure's durability and strength. This is particularly important for families that plan to re-use the beds as their children get older.

A good rule of the thumb is to leave at least 33-36 inches between the mattress's top and the ceiling, says Rebecca Simon, a designer with Maison Ellie Interiors for Kids. If you don't wish to sacrifice that much space, you might prefer a low height bunk bed. "That is a great solution for a small space because it keeps the lower bed from the floor, which could feel cramped as kids get older."

Another consideration is deciding how much space you have for stairs or ladders. While a bunk with stairs built in can save space, it could also be costly and require more assembly time. If you are short on space, choose a simple ladder to allow your children to safely climb to the top of the bunk.

Style

Bunk beds come in a variety of sizes and shapes, so you will be able to choose one that best suits your family's requirements. For example there are traditional twin-over-twin bunks and specialized configurations like queen-over-twin or twin-over-queen beds. Some are made from metal and some are made of wood with side rails that are placed on top of the bunk. The design of the frame and other features can also vary and you'll need to think about the amount of storage you require and what style you like the most.

Klugh recommends that when evaluating the price of a bunkbed it is essential to remember that the higher price point the more customizable the bed will be. This could include adding additional features like a staircase or ladder. This could also be the possibility of incorporating an extra bed for sleepovers or guests. Some models can even be disassembled to function as two beds, which is a great feature to consider if your children will outgrow the bunk beds or you are planning on moving to a different home in the future.

The number of beds that you select will also impact the price and design. For instance, you could select a basic twin over twin bunk bed that maximizes floor space and is relatively affordable bunk beds for kids. You could also choose to invest more in bunk beds made of solid wood with an elegant, sturdy design that grows with your children and possibly accommodate adult sleepers in the future.

Regardless of the size and design you choose, it's important to check the capacity to bear weight of the bunk beds adults beds best to ensure that they are able to support the number of sleepers that you'll be using them for. Some are designed for kids only and can only support up to 165 pounds, while others have a greater weight limit that allow the beds to be able to accommodate growing children and even adults.

It's also important to note that a bunk bed could be a significant investment, and therefore an enormous commitment. If you're not sure if this type of bed is suitable for your family, visit the showroom of a particular retailer or read customer reviews on their website. This will give you a feel about the quality of workmanship and the way in which the bunks are made.

Stores

Furniture should be able serve more than just as a place to study, sleep and relax. Bunk beds that have built-in storage can meet this requirement making them multi-functional pieces that are both functional and stylish. Multifunctional staircases and drawers with storage integrated are innovative features that allow for easy access to clothes, toys and bedding linens.

Additionally loft beds that have spacious desk areas transform the space underneath them into productive workspaces. These smart arrangements allow young students or remote workers to combine work with play and sleep without sacrificing valuable floor space.

Another option to consider is detachable bunks that are separated into separate twin-size beds, which are ideal for sleeping over guests or allowing children to move to single beds as they develop. Bunks with trundle beds that can be removed can be adapted to older children or adults who prefer to sleep on a full-size mattress.

Furthermore, bunks that allow for sleeping three or more are a good investment for families looking to maximize space in bedrooms with high ceilings. These models can be fitted into small spaces, allowing owners to make the most of the space that would otherwise be wasted.

The kind of material and color your bunk bed is constructed from will impact its overall look and feel. Wood bunks have a classic timeless appeal that fits well in contemporary, coastal and farmhouse interiors. Steel bunks, on the other hand, are a more modern option that works well with midcentury and industrial designs.

Be aware of the ceiling's height and windows in the vicinity, as well as other architectural features when shopping for bunk beds. Lower, compact styles are simpler to put together. They are perfect for teens or younger children who are ready to get from the bedroom for toddlers or juniors. These bunks are taller and have a sophisticated, airier look, and are best suited to older kids or adults. Some designs feature side railings which allow for an increased space between the beds. This ensures the safety of everyone.
